, the expression of ideas and emotions, with the development of specific aesthetic top qualities, in a two-dimensional visual language. The aspects of this languageits shapes, lines, colours, tones, and texturesare utilized in numerous means to produce feelings of quantity, room, movement, and light on a flat surface. These components are combined into meaningful patterns in order to represent real or mythological phenomena, to analyze a narrative motif, or to develop completely abstract visual relationships.


Later the notion of the "great artist" established in Asia and Renaissance Europe. Noticeable painters were managed the social status of scholars and courtiers; they authorized their work, decided its layout and often its subject and images, and developed a more personalif not constantly amicablerelationship with their clients. Throughout the 19th century painters in Western cultures began to shed their social placement and safe patronage.
